logo

Output 22791274db60ddafb077277d4a2b8ecbb3f6c49b8b653e688e227acfabc6d781:0

value
10940023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ca8a400051d9f28ba62e6f5c77c56b7485d4c0f OP_EQUALVERIFY OP_CHECKSIG
address
1DpjdDKFxXs8QEp9BX4uiKR5RSZ5TgMxz1
transaction
22791274db60ddafb077277d4a2b8ecbb3f6c49b8b653e688e227acfabc6d781